With Yann Kermorgant claiming a hat trick on his full debut, he's laid down a challenge to Simin Francis for more of the same where crosses are concerned.

Speaking in the Bournemouth Evening Echo, Francis is quoted as saying: "Yann said he wanted more of the same from me and that I would definitely be getting more assists if I kept putting balls in like that, which was nice of him to say. They were pretty good crosses. The first one took a little bobble and I noticed and just tried to caress it in and fortunately it landed on his head. The second one I knew where he’d be and just put a ball in an area. A striker of Yann’s quality wants good balls delivered into the area and I think he got that all day. Fortunately for me, I chipped in with a couple. I don’t think I’ve gone as long as I have since my first assist. It was nice for me, although of course the important thing is winning games. As an attacking full-back, I want to be involved with the goals. I want to score more and create more and Saturday was perfect really".
